Portfolio Construction 101
Step 1: Define Your Goals
Time horizon and risk tolerance determine your asset allocation. Long-term goals allow for more equity exposure.
Step 2: Choose Your Allocation
A classic starting point is 60% stocks and 40% bonds. Adjust based on age and risk appetite.
Step 3: Diversify Within Asset Classes
Within stocks, spread across sectors and geographies. Consider both domestic and international exposure.
Step 4: Rebalance Regularly
Review your portfolio quarterly or annually. Sell winners and buy underperformers to maintain target allocation.
